It is with great sadness that we announce the passing of Annie (Hanson) Plummer on December 27, 2010, at the age of 92 at Dunrovin with her family at her side.

Annie was born on September 9, 1918 in Asquith Saskatchewan. In 1938 she married John Hanson and they moved to New Westminister where their son and daughter were born. In 1951 the family moved to Quesnel where their third child was born.

John passed away in 1964 and she later moved to Walhachin where she married Sid Plummer. After Sids death she returned to Quesnel to be closer to her family.
